How it works
Vit K 1mg Injection is a synthetic form of vitamin K. It restores the activity of vitamin K and speeds up the normal blood clotting process to prevent or treat bleeding caused due to too high a dose of warfarin.

Frequently asked questions
What is Vit K 1mg Injection used for?
Vit K 1mg Injection is used to treat bleeding (hemorrhage or threatened hemorrhage) associated with a low blood level of prothrombin or factor VII. It is also used to treat vitamin K deficiency in the body. Vitamin K is an essential nutrient that is necessary for blood clotting and bone metabolism. Vit K 1mg Injection helps to improve conditions caused by low levels of vitamin K in the body.
How does Vit K 1mg Injection work?
Vit K 1mg Injection works by promoting the formation of clotting factors (factors required for normal blood clotting). This prevents bleeding after the use of blood thinning medications (anticoagulants).
